As hydrogen draws a more attention as an alternative energy source, people’s interest in how to produce hydrogen has also increased. The most common hydrogen production method is to use by-product hydrogen through the separation of hydrogen-mixed gases generated during the petrochemical process. In addition, there is a way to reform of natural gases produced through decomposition into high-temperature/high-pressure vapor. The reforming of natural gases is the most common method which enables hydrogen production at low prices. Lastly, there is an electrolysis method which enables the acquisition of hydrogen through water electrolysis.

Since hydrogen purity has a significant influence on performances such as fuel cells, refining technology is crucial in acquiring high-purity hydrogen.
A hydrogen dryer is a system designed to purify hydrogen by eliminating oxygen in the hydrogen, using the palladium (Pd) catalyst and adsorbent.

Features and Operating Mechanism

Operating Mechanism

A H2 dryer is apparatus designed to adsorb and remove water through hydrogen-oxygen reaction, using a desiccant in the absorber. The hydrogen is heated up to about 100℃ for easy reaction in the pre-heater and the heated hydrogen gas flows into the catalyst tower filled with palladium. In a catalyst tower, water is generated through hydrogen-oxygen reaction. This water is cooled and flown into an absorption tower for easy adsorption with hydrogen in the pre-cooler.
The water produced while being cooled in the pre-cooler is drained out.

The two absorption towers remove water by taking turns. While one absorption tower is executing drying process, the other one engages in regeneration process to remove the absorbed water.

The regeneration process designed to eliminate absorbed water in the desiccant is divided into heating and cooling processes. During the heating process, a desiccant is regenerated while removing and cooling the adsorbed moisture by heating the desiccant, using hydrogen heated by the regeneration heater and regeneration cooler. Once the heating regeneration process is complete, the cooling process targeted to reduce the temperature of the dried desiccant is initiated. Then, the regeneration heater stops.

If the desiccant regeneration is done, two absorption towers are switched. In the tower where adsorption is performed, then, the regeneration process is executed. In the tower where such regeneration process is completed, absorption is executed.

H2 Dryer Applications and Installation

  • Purifies hydrogen produced in the hydrogen PSA
  • Purifies hydrogen produced through the electrolysis system
  • Purifies hydrogen by installing the system in the hydrogen supply line
  • Required to provide cooling water and hot steam
  • Able to design an explosion-proof heater instead of hot steam
